On-Chip firmware reads and writes High Speed
Memory Stick and MS PRO
1-bit ECC correction performed in hardware for
maximum efficiency
Hardware support for SD Security Command
Extensions
3.3 Volt I/O with 5V input tolerance on VBUS, Port
Power and Over-Current Sense pins
On-chip power FETs for supplying flash media
card power with minimum board components
8051 8 bit microprocessor
- Provides low speed control functions
- 30 MHz execution speed at 4 cycles per
instruction average
- 12K Bytes of internal SRAM for general pur-
pose scratchpad
- 768 Bytes of internal SRAM for general pur-
pose scratchpad or program execution while
re-flashing external ROM
- Double Buffered Bulk Endpoint
- Bi-directional 512 Byte Buffer for Bulk End-
point
- 64 Byte RX Control Endpoint Buffer
- 64 Byte TX Control Endpoint Buffer
Internal Program Memory Interface
- 64K Byte Internal Code Space
On Board 24MHz Crystal Driver Circuit
Can be clocked by an external 24MHz source
On-Chip 1.8V Regulator for Low Power Core
Operation
Internal PLL for 480MHz USB 2.0 Sampling, Con-
figurable MCU clock
11 GPIOs for special function use: LED indicators,
button inputs, power control to memory devices,
etc.
- Inputs capable of generating interrupts with
either edge sensitivity
Configuration of Hub and Flash Media features
controlled either by internal defaults or via single
external EEPROM. User configurable features:
- Full or Partial Card compliance checking
- LUN configuration and assignment
- Write Protect Polarity
- Cover Switch operation for xD compliance
- Inquiry Command operation
- SD Write Protect operation
- Older CF card support
- Force USB 1.1 reporting
- Internal or External Power FET operation
Compatible with Microsoft WinXP, WinME, Win2K
SP3&4, Apple OS10 and Linux Multi-LUN Mass
Storage Class Drivers
Win2K, Win98/98SE and Apple OS8.6 and OS9
Multi-LUN Mass Storage Class Drivers are avail-
able from Microchip
128-Pin TQFP Package (1.0mm height, 14mm
x14mm footprint); RoHS compliant package also
available
